Continue reading →Mohair production in South Africa comes with great responsibility.
Mohair South Africa was established to assume this responsibility to develop and maintain industry standards in order to ensure ethical and sustainable practices, and provide ongoing support for the South African mohair sector.
Mohair South Africa seeks to advance the mohair industry through international partnerships and alliances to enhance the production and consumption of mohair products. Our aim is to create sustainable demand and profitability for all role players from producer to processor, and from buyer to manufacturer.

Continue reading →ICASA is responsible for regulating the telecommunications, broadcasting and postal industries in the public interest and ensure affordable services of a high quality for all South Africans. It also issues licences to telecommunications and broadcasting service providers, enforces compliance with rules and regulations, protects consumers from unfair business practices and poor quality services, hears and decides on disputes and complaints brought against licensees, and controls and manages the effective use of radio frequency spectrum
